Henrietta was a very normal ladybird who lived in a garden full of plants and flowers. And what very normal ladybirds have? Well, they have a bright and red shell and five black spots well distributed that are the pride of their species. But one day early in the morning Henrietta was surprised to see all her spots had flown. Did someone stolen them? Had they faded away? She could only do one thing: go searching the missing spots.

On friendship and cooperation.
